Author: David Rigsbee
Russian-American poet Joseph Brodsky is one of the most celebrated poets of our time, preoccupied with the nature and destiny of poetry in our era. This volume analyzes Brodsky's career in terms of his key elegies and investigates the critical role of elegiac thinking in postmodernist poetics.
